Realme is all set to launch its much-awaited Realme 6i in India on July 24. It is believed that Realme 6i is a rebranded version of the Realme 6s which has been officially launched in Europe. The 6i is expected to compete with the Redmi Note 9 head-on in India.

Madhav Sheth, CEO of Realme, took on Twitter to announce the arrival of midrange Realme 6i in India. Apart from the launch date, other details like 90Hz display, Helio G90T processor, quad rear cameras, and a punch-hole screen panel are out as well.

Realme 6i Features

Realme 6i will allegedly come with a 6.5-inch FHD+ display with a 90Hz refresh rate and a 90.5% screen-to-body ratio. The left corner of the screen has a punch-hole to house the selfie camera. For photography, Realme 6i is expected to include quad-rear cameras with a 48MP primary shooter, 8MP Ultra wide-angle lens (119° FoV), a 2MP macro lens, and B&W portrait lens.

The Realme 6i gets octa-core MediaTek Helio G90T gaming processor coupled with Mali G76 graphics. The smartphone may arrive in a single variant of 4GB LPDDR4x RAM, and 64GB inbuilt storage, expandable up to 512GB via a microSD card. The device runs on Realme UI based on Android 10 operating system.

The phone is rumored to have a 4300mAh battery with 30W Dart charge support. Realme 6i comes with a side-mounted fingerprint sensor on the power button. Connectivity options include dual 4G, WiFi6, Bluetooth 5.0, and a 3.5mm headphone jack.

Realme 6i Price and Availability

The twin of Realme 6i i.e. Realme 6s is priced at 199 euros (around Rs 17,000) in the European market. Realme 69 price in India is expected to be significantly lower. The phone will ship in Lunar White and Eclipse Black color options.
